Biological regulation of plagues in the cultivation of the bean (Phaseolus vulgaris L.) in the province of Ciego of Avila, Cuba

Abstract
The essay was carried out with de objective of determining the key plagues and their regulation with biological pesticides in the cultivation of the bean, in the province of Ciego of Ávila. The effects of the boundary to analyze their possible consequence in the appearance of the insects, and the incidence and distribution of the noxious organisms were determined. The technical effectiveness and the virulence of the biological alternatives applied, as well as the economic valuation were also evaluated. An analysis of simple variance was applied with the test of multiple ranges of Duncan with 5% of error probability for the comparison of the average values. It was carried out the adjustment of the polynomial equation and the calculation of the coefficient of determination. A statistical package SSPS version 17 was used. The incidence of the plagues was not determined by the effect of the boundary. The values of the intensity and distribution in the treatments were: Empoasca kraemeri 2,6% and 16%; Diabrotica balteata 2,6% and 5%; Andrector ruficornis 1,6% and 18%. The technical effectiveness of Metarhizium anisopliae in the regulation of Empoasca kraemeri was 88%, while technical effectiveness of Beauveria bassiana in the regulation of Diabrotica balteata and Andrector ruficornis was 76%. It is economically justified the biological alternative for the regulation of the pests in the cultivation of the bean, with a relationship benefit/cost equal to 1, 2.
